Air pollution: how does it affect you?

More than 80% of people living in urban areas where air pollution is monitored are exposed to air quality levels that excede World Health Organisation limits, according to the latest urban air quality data released by the agency.

The data suggests populations in low-income cities are particularly under threat from the effects of air pollution.

The WHO have previous said that air polution is now a global “public health emergency” that will have untold financial implications for governments.

Fast-growing cities in the Middle East, south-east Asia and the western Pacific are the most impacted. India has 16 of the world’s 30 most polluted cities.

Air polution was described as a “public health emergency” by a cross-party committee of MPs last month. The new London mayor will come under pressure to do something about the city’s terrible record on pollution.
